Lipid-In, Sugar-Out: Early Results of Treatment with Additional Ketogenic Parenteral Nutrition in Left Ventricle Assist Device Patients.

Abstract

Background and Aims: Right ventricle failure (RVF) can be a fatal complication following left ventricle assist device (LVAD) implant. Careful intra and postoperative management is becoming increasingly important. Unfortunately, the attempts are limited to the prediction and not to the treatment. There are no data on Ketogenic parenteral nutrition (KPN) for the targeted treatment of RVF. The aim of our retrospective observational case-control study is to determine whether KPN may play a role as additional treatment to conventional therapy after LVAD implantation. Material: and Methods: This is a retrospective single center analysis of a case series on prospectively collected data. From February 2012 to April 2021, 192 patients have been implanted with an LVAD. All the patients were managed with optimal medical and surgical therapy. One-hundred-seven patients were treated with additional KPN as adjuvant therapy against and in prevention of acute RVF (KPN-Group), defined according to International Society Heart and Lung Transplantation (ISHLT) guidelines. The remaining 85 patients, managed without KPN, constituted our control group (No-KPN-Group). Results: : In KPN-Group acute-RVF occurred in 31 patients (29%), while causing death in 14 patients (13%). In the No-KPN-Group acute-RVF was observed in 32 patients (37.6%), while causing death in 20 patients (23.5%). According to echocardiographic and hemodynamic results, the majority of KPN-Group patients responded with RV function improvement (range 4-60% of TAPSE increase, p<0.05) with recovery of RV function in 85% of the patients (91/107). In No-KPN-Group RV functional recovery was observed in 65 patients (76.4%). Overall intra-hospital mortality was 23.4% (25) and 27.1% (23) in KPN-Group and No-KPN-Group, respectively (p=0.337). While Intensive Care Unit (ICU) stay was comparable (p=0.078), ward-stay was significantly shorter in KPN-Group (p=0.03). Conclusion: KPN was well tolerated. A complete recovery of the RV function was achieved in the majority of the patients and results lasted beyond the duration of KPN. Future research to understand the underlying mechanism, and identification of suitable patients and treatment duration is necessary.
